Largest reported grants

The biggest individual grants on file, as reported by the foundation to the IRS.

RecipientLocationPurposeTax yearAmount
Accelerate ChangeBoston, MAgeneral support for voter engagement2024$400K
Immigrant Justice CorpsNew York, NYsupport for two consecutive cohorts of three Jane Blaustein Justice Fellows2024$285K
Equis InstituteWashington, DCgeneral support for Voter Engagement research2024$200K
American Civil Liberties Union FoundationNew York, NYrenewed support for the Voting Rights Project2024$150K
American Civil Liberties Union FoundationNew York, NYrenewed support for the Voting Rights Project2024$150K
NEO PhilanthropyNew York, NYsupport for the Analyst Institute Civic Engagement Research & Dissemination Hub2024$150K
Arizona Public MediaTucson, AZsupport for the Bridging Communities Capital Campaign2024$115K
Native American Rights FundBoulder, COsupport for two consecutive two-year Jane Blaustein Law Fellows2024$113.5K
Ground Game FundAustin, TXsupport for DJs at the Polls2024$100K
Physicians for Human RightsNew York, NYrenewed support for the project, "Do No Harm: Countering Violations of Medical Ethics, Standards of Care, and Human Rights in the Post-Dobbs United States"2024$100K
Ground Game FundAustin, TXsupport for Focus for Democracy regranting fund2024$100K
The BrotherhoodSister SolNew York, NYrenewed general support for education and social justice opportunities for youth in Harlem2024$90K
Partners for Dignity & RightsNew York, NYrenewed support for the Dignity in Schools Campaign - New York coalition2024$80K
AneraWashington, DCemergency support for humanitarian aid in Gaza2024$80K
Physicians for Human RightsNew York, NYsupport for a research and capacity development project to investigate attacks on health care workers in Gaza2024$80K
Inside Climate NewsBrooklyn, NYrenewed support for an environmental reporter covering Baltimore and Maryland2024$80K
Disability Rights MarylandBaltimore, MDrenewed support to expand legal services and advocacy to the disproportionate number of students with disabilities involved in the school discipline process2024$80K
Amica Center for Immigrant RightsWashington, DCrenewed general support to provide legal assistance and advocacy for immigrants at risk for deportation in Maryland and the DC Region2024$80K
International Medical CorpsLos Angeles, CAemergency support for humanitarian aid in Gaza2024$80K
Chesapeake Climate Action NetworkTakoma Park, MDrenewed general support for regional campaigns to promote clean energy2024$75K
Catholic Charities of BaltimoreBaltimore, MDrenewed support for the Immigration Legal Services program at the Esperanza Center2024$75K
The Fund for New Citizens at the New York Community TrustNew York, NYrenewed support for the Fund for New Citizens, a funding collaborative providing grants to small, immigrant-led non-profits in New York City2024$75K
Johns Hopkins Center for SaludHealth & Opportunities for LatinosBaltimore, MDsupport to replicate Terra Firma in Baltimore, a model program to provide legal representation, health and mental health care for unaccompanied immigrant children2024$75K
Florence Immigrant And Refugee Rights Project IncTucson, AZrenewed general support for free legal and social services for immigrant individuals and families in detention2024$75K
The Johns Hopkins UniversityBaltimore, MDgeneral support for HEAL2024$75K

How to apply

This foundation publishes application instructions on its latest 990-PF and does not report restricting giving to preselected organizations. See more foundations that accept applications.

Contact
Jeanne P Blaustein President CO Ms
Address
BPG One South Street Ste 2900 Baltimore, MD, 212023334
Phone
4103477201
Deadlines
None
Application materials
Letter
Restrictions
This organization does not make gifts or grants to individuals.
